A two-fluid hydrodynamical model describing the modification of a stellar wind flow due to its interaction with galactic cosmic-rays is investigated. The two fluids consist of the thermal stellar wind gas and the galactic cosmic-rays. A polytropic one fluid model is used to describe the stellar wind gas, and the cosmic rays modify the wind via their pressure gradient. The equations used are essentially those employed in two fluid hydrodynamical models of cosmic-ray shock acceleration by the first order Fermi mechanism, but suitably modified to apply in a spherical geometry and including the effects of gravity on the flow. The model shows the deceleration of the wind upstream of the shock by the positive galactic cosmic-ray pressure gradient. The fluid polytropic stellar winds are discussed and how to insert shock in the flow. A description of the singularities of the equations is also presented. The system of equations is first solved by a finite difference method in the test particle approximation with appropriate boundary conditions applied at infinity, at the wind termination shock, and at the star. A perturbation scheme to determine the modification of the wind by the cosmic rays is then developed. Finally a numerical iteration is employed to exactly solve the equations.
